Analysis

The most recent figure for gross capital formation in Pakistan is 58.17 billion current US$, measured in 2025.

The figure is up 18.6% on the previous year and up 22.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, gross capital formation in Pakistan peaked at 60.78 billion current US$ in 2018 and was at its lowest, 507.35 million current US$, in 1960.

That places Pakistan 51st out of 185 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1960s 1.03 billion current US$ 507.35 million current US$ 1.42 billion current US$ 10
1970s 1.99 billion current US$ 817.84 million current US$ 3.37 billion current US$ 10
1980s 5.91 billion current US$ 4.18 billion current US$ 7.60 billion current US$ 10
1990s 10.22 billion current US$ 7.58 billion current US$ 12.03 billion current US$ 10
2000s 23.91 billion current US$ 14.65 billion current US$ 36.39 billion current US$ 10
2010s 44.56 billion current US$ 31.40 billion current US$ 60.78 billion current US$ 10
2020s 51.30 billion current US$ 44.51 billion current US$ 58.34 billion current US$ 6

Gross capital formation includes acquisitions less disposals of produced assets for purposes of fixed capital formation, inventories or valuables. This indicator is expressed in current prices, meaning no adjustment has been made to account for price changes over time. This indicator is expressed in United States dollars.
